The Essence of Modern Living Room Design

A modern living room combines simplicity with warmth. Think minimal clutter, thoughtful details, and quality over quantity. The goal is to curate pieces that complement one another, rather than compete for attention.

Neutral color palettes - such as beige, charcoal, ivory, and taupe - are often the foundation. Then, layered textures like soft wool rugs, linen curtains, and matte finishes bring the space to life.

Modern design doesn’t mean cold or sterile. It’s about creating balance: sleek lines paired with plush comfort, metallic accents softened by organic materials, and neutral backdrops enriched by bold art or lighting.

1. Start with a Sleek Foundation

Every great living room begins with a statement piece. A modern sectional sofa in a neutral tone is the perfect base. Look for clean silhouettes and performance fabric for both style and durability. Complement it with a rectangular marble or glass coffee table - an instant way to elevate your space while maintaining visual lightness.

2. Layer Textures for Warmth

Modern interiors thrive on texture. Mixing materials like linen, velvet, metal, and natural wood keeps the space visually engaging.

  • A plush wool area rug instantly grounds the space and adds comfort underfoot.

  • Add a velvet armchair or accent chair in deep emerald or cognac tones for a subtle touch of luxury (look for styles over $120 for higher-quality fabric and build).

Texture doesn’t stop at furniture - consider woven wall decor, boucle throws, or matte ceramic vases for a refined, tactile look.

3. Lighting Makes All the Difference

Lighting sets the mood and defines your design aesthetic. A modern living room benefits from layered lighting – ambient, accent, and task lighting.

  • Install a statement chandelier or pendant light as your centerpiece.

  • Add sleek brass or matte black floor lamps beside the sofa for warm ambient light.

4. Play with Contrasts

Contrast is key to keeping your modern living room visually dynamic. Combine light and dark tones, glossy and matte finishes, soft fabrics and structured furniture.

Try pairing a black media console with light oak shelves, or hang minimalist art against a deep charcoal wall.

7. Invest Where It Counts

When decorating a modern living room, invest in the pieces that anchor the space: the sofa, coffee table, and lighting. Quality shows, and timeless design ensures longevity.

8. Make It Personal

Modern doesn’t mean impersonal. Layer in meaningful pieces - travel souvenirs, coffee table books, or framed memories. The key is restraint: curate, don’t clutter.

Mix a few conversation pieces into your design. It’s these personal touches that transform a modern living room from showroom-perfect to soulfully lived-in.

Final Touch: Balance and Flow

A well-designed modern living room flows naturally. Keep walkways clear, furniture proportionate to the room size, and visual lines clean. Every item should have purpose and harmony within the bigger picture.

If your space feels cohesive, comfortable, and easy to move through, you’ve achieved modern perfection.
